> Hm, what was wrong? I mean, ln -s was exit 0, but actually failed?
Yep - "ln -s foo bar" works, gets you bar.exe (which tries to call
"foo" when invoked) on DOS; this is exactly why AC_PROG_LN_S was patched
and why the ln -s setup was added to m4sh.
